Output 3df73d2386a62cb18c3fd9e53f3cc065de84d3ef460f103441798d568b1d5983:0

value
17717978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4bb8648bd179dacc413b947018b50c4fd54402 OP_EQUAL
address
3QscGQWv8zUhjSSK6Bq1PCtxHBKRex3KL8
transaction
3df73d2386a62cb18c3fd9e53f3cc065de84d3ef460f103441798d568b1d5983
spent
true